.CalendarHeader_header__owU_f{display:flex;align-items:flex-start;justify-content:flex-start;padding:0;flex-shrink:0}.CalendarHeader_content__r_vJu{font-family:var(--font-mono);text-transform:uppercase;font-size:var(--font-size-1);color:var(--color-white);letter-spacing:.15em;font-weight:400;background:var(--color-black-cherry);padding:var(--unit-4) var(--unit-15) var(--unit-3) var(--unit-4);width:100%}.DateCell_cell__az5So{position:relative;font-family:var(--font-mono);min-height:0;min-width:0;width:100%;height:100%;color:var(--color-iron);transition:all .2s ease-in-out;border:none;background:transparent;cursor:pointer;padding:var(--unit-4);aspect-ratio:1/1}.DateCell_cell__az5So.DateCell_selected__f5xMR{-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px)}.DateCell_cell__az5So.DateCell_currentDay__ITmpG,.DateCell_cell__az5So.DateCell_selected__f5xMR,.DateCell_cell__az5So:not(.DateCell_selected__f5xMR):not(.DateCell_currentDay__ITmpG):hover{box-shadow:0 0 24px 0 var(--color-pollen) inset}.DateCell_cell__az5So.DateCell_newlyLoaded__s7TnV{opacity:0}.DateCell_title__OQSJS{font-size:var(--font-size-1);font-family:var(--font-mono);font-weight:400;color:var(--color-iron);z-index:1}.DateCell_indicatorContainer__UGYhl,.DateCell_title__OQSJS{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.DateCell_indicatorContainer__UGYhl{display:flex;flex-direction:column;align-items:center;gap:var(--unit-2);z-index:10}.DateCell_noteItem__KwQFd{display:flex;align-items:center;gap:.25rem}.DateCell_dot__fSLKn{width:.25rem;height:.25rem;border-radius:9999px}.DateCell_identifier__5117F{font-size:.75rem;font-family:var(--font-mono),"Courier New",monospace}.Calendar_wrapper__Ee_8_{width:30%;height:100vh;overflow-y:auto;background:var(--color-sulphur);box-shadow:0 0 64px 12px var(--color-pollen) inset;transform:translateZ(0);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.Calendar_content__PfMcC,.Calendar_wrapper__Ee_8_{display:flex;flex-direction:column}.Calendar_grid__WZGPj{flex-shrink:0;display:grid;grid-template-columns:repeat(3,minmax(0,1fr));grid-auto-rows:auto;padding:var(--unit-8);position:relative;gap:var(--unit-4)}.Calendar_monthCell__2Mz2G{position:relative;aspect-ratio:1/1;min-width:0;min-height:0}.Calendar_crossHair__fWK68{position:absolute;background:var(--color-iron-20);transform:translateZ(0);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.Calendar_crossHairTopLeft__Ut0bn{top:0;left:0;width:.75rem;height:1px}.Calendar_crossHairTopLeftVertical__t4KEj{top:0;left:0;width:1px;height:.75rem}.Calendar_crossHairTopRight__XNnem{top:0;right:0;width:.75rem;height:1px}.Calendar_crossHairTopRightVertical__mn2UG{top:0;right:0;width:1px;height:.75rem}.Calendar_crossHairBottomLeft__OOPE8{bottom:0;left:0;width:.75rem;height:1px}.Calendar_crossHairBottomLeftVertical__RdH0_{bottom:0;left:0;width:1px;height:.75rem}.Calendar_crossHairBottomRight__8aqvM{bottom:0;right:0;width:.75rem;height:1px}.Calendar_crossHairBottomRightVertical__5jouE{bottom:0;right:0;width:1px;height:.75rem}.Calendar_label__mRtBy{position:absolute;font-size:var(--font-size-1);color:var(--color-iron);letter-spacing:.1em;font-weight:400}.Calendar_monthLabel__vLMID{font-family:var(--font-sans);text-transform:uppercase;letter-spacing:.1em}.Calendar_dateLabel__jfU_J{font-family:var(--font-mono)}.Calendar_labelTopLeft__ls4gi{top:var(--unit-5);left:var(--unit-5)}.Calendar_labelBottomRight__WLhNr{bottom:var(--unit-5);right:var(--unit-5)}.Calendar_loading__9pofO{display:flex;justify-content:center;align-items:center;padding:2rem 0;animation:Calendar_pulse__nv_ac 2s cubic-bezier(.4,0,.6,1) infinite}.Calendar_loadingText__8J9jS{font-family:var(--font-mono),"Courier New",monospace;color:#241815;opacity:.5}.Calendar_endMessage__XmMQg{display:flex;justify-content:center;align-items:center;padding:2rem 0}.Calendar_endMessageText__An1VI{font-family:var(--font-mono),"Courier New",monospace;color:#241815;opacity:.5}.Calendar_fadeBottom__OLWHW{position:sticky;bottom:0;left:0;right:0;height:200px;background:linear-gradient(to bottom,transparent,var(--color-pollen));pointer-events:none;z-index:10;margin-top:auto;transform:translateZ(0);backface-visibility:hidden;-webkit-backface-visibility:hidden;will-change:transform}@keyframes Calendar_pulse__nv_ac{0%,to{opacity:1}50%{opacity:.5}}.PostsPanel_emptyState__65N6K{padding:var(--unit-10);text-align:center;font-family:var(--font-sans)}.PostsPanel_grid__y1fCW{width:70%;height:100vh;overflow-y:auto;padding:0;display:flex;flex-direction:column;gap:var(--unit-12);background:#E3E1CE}.PostsPanel_postContainer__oATKa{display:flex;flex-direction:column;justify-content:space-between;gap:var(--unit-9);height:100%}.PostsPanel_header__G4dtz{display:flex;justify-content:flex-start;align-items:center;padding:0;position:fixed}.PostsPanel_title__6SGMH{background:var(--color-white)}.PostsPanel_date__IaZJn,.PostsPanel_title__6SGMH{font-family:var(--font-mono);font-size:var(--font-size-1);color:var(--color-black-cherry);letter-spacing:.15em;text-transform:uppercase;font-weight:500;padding:var(--unit-4) var(--unit-15) var(--unit-3) var(--unit-4);width:380px}.PostsPanel_date__IaZJn{background:var(--color-pickled-olive)}.PostsPanel_postRow__7REmn{display:grid;grid-template-columns:repeat(9,1fr);grid-template-rows:auto 1fr;gap:var(--unit-5)}.PostsPanel_content__DwuAF{grid-column:3/6;grid-row:1;font-family:var(--font-serif);color:var(--color-black-cherry);white-space:pre-wrap;padding:var(--unit-17) 0 var(--unit-12) 0}.PostsPanel_visualsContainer__ogvWV{grid-column:1/9;grid-row:2;display:flex;flex-direction:row;gap:var(--unit-4);overflow-x:auto;overflow-y:hidden;padding:var(--unit-8);align-items:flex-start;width:100%;scrollbar-width:thin;scrollbar-color:var(--color-black-cherry) transparent}.PostsPanel_visualsContainer__ogvWV::-webkit-scrollbar{height:8px}.PostsPanel_visualsContainer__ogvWV::-webkit-scrollbar-track{background:transparent}.PostsPanel_visualsContainer__ogvWV::-webkit-scrollbar-thumb{background:var(--color-black-cherry);border-radius:4px}.PostsPanel_mediaWrapper__cpfPU{display:flex;flex-direction:column;gap:var(--unit-4);flex-shrink:1;min-width:200px;max-width:500px}.PostsPanel_annotation__cL_ov{font-family:var(--font-sans);font-size:var(--font-size-2);color:#796B6B;letter-spacing:.01em}.PostsPanel_content__DwuAF p{margin-bottom:var(--unit-9);text-indent:var(--unit-12);font-family:var(--font-serif)}.PostsPanel_imageContainer__Umt4O{display:flex;align-items:center;justify-content:center;width:100%;min-height:200px;object-fit:contain;position:relative}.PostsPanel_imageContainer__Umt4O: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background-color:var(--color-pollen);mix-blend-mode:soft-light;pointer-events:none;z-index:1}.PostsPanel_imageContainer__Umt4O:after{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background-color:var(--color-sulphur);mix-blend-mode:darken;pointer-events:none;z-index:2}.PostsPanel_imageContainer__Umt4O video,.PostsPanel_image__PRhYZ{width:100%;height:auto;object-fit:contain;filter:grayscale(100%)}.page_loadingContainer__BwSwt{min-height:100vh;display:flex;align-items:center;justify-content:center;background:#E3E1CE}.page_loadingText__0accJ{font-family:var(--font-mono),"Courier New",monospace;color:#241815}.page_mainContainer__7JEvY{display:flex;width:100%;height:100vh;background:#E3E1CE}.page_calendarPanel__7F0kq,.page_postsPanel__rb0fo{width:50%;height:100vh;overflow-y:auto}